The Drawing Center and Lower Manhattan Cultural Council present DrawNow!, a project of The Big Draw. Organized as part of the River to River Festival, this four-part series will be presented on Governors Island on June 23–24 and June 30–July 1 at 2pm each day. Now in its seventh year in New York, The Big Draw series is a celebration of drawing inspired by the wildly popular United Kingdom program of the same name. On Governors Island, visitors of all ages will explore drawing as a way to relate to their city, waterfront, and landscape, through site-specific artist-led projects. FREE – no experience necessary!
